Wood cladding repair services involve the restoration and maintenance of exterior or interior wooden wall coverings on properties. These services typically address issues such as rotting, warping, cracking, and other forms of damage caused by exposure to weather elements or age. Skilled professionals assess the condition of the existing cladding, identify areas requiring attention, and perform necessary repairs or replacements to restore the wood’s structural integrity and appearance. Proper repair work helps prolong the lifespan of the cladding and maintains the property's aesthetic appeal.
This service is essential for resolving common problems associated with wood cladding, including moisture infiltration, pest infestation, and deterioration over time. When wood becomes compromised, it can lead to further structural issues or reduce insulation efficiency. Repairing damaged sections helps prevent the spread of decay, protects the underlying wall structures, and enhances the overall durability of the property. Addressing these issues promptly can also prevent more costly repairs in the future and preserve the property's value.

What types of damage can wood cladding repair services address? They can repair issues such as rot, warping, cracks, and damage caused by pests or weather conditions.
How do professionals typically repair damaged wood cladding? Repairs often involve replacing or patching affected sections, sanding, and applying protective finishes to restore appearance and durability.
Is wood cladding repair suitable for all types of wood? Most repair services can accommodate various wood types, but it’s best to consult with local pros about specific materials.
What are common signs that wood cladding needs repair? Visible cracks, peeling paint, discoloration, or sagging panels are indicators that repairs may be necessary.
